Liver Detoxification Breakfast Drink

This is a great liver cleansing tonic which also tastes good. Substitute your usual glass of orange juice in the morning with this drink for a tasty liver detox. You will need:

  • 1 cucumber
  • 1 stick of celery
  • 1/2 a beetroot
  • 1 carrot
  • a dash of pepper or salt for taste

Scrub clean the carrot and beetroot and then juice everything, adding pepper or salt to taste. Be sure to drink it within 30 minutes before the juices begin to separate. This is a very high vitamin juice with natural liver restoratives, it tastes great and is easy to prepare.
